A leading ductwork & ventilation contractor is seeking an Estimator to join their North London office. The role involves preparing cost estimates for HVAC ductwork on commercial projects, reviewing specifications, and collaborating with teams on bids.

This position offers a salary of £65,000 - £70,000, including benefits such as a car allowance and 23 days holiday. This Estimator will be pivotal in supporting project management through the bidding process.
